Bland-Allison Act



         


1878 was a response to the Crime of '73 demonetizing silver. Representative Silver Dick Bland of Missouri introduced this bill for the free coinage of silver at ratio of 16:1 to gold. Senator William Allison of Iowa added a provision that limited the amount purchased to 4 million dollars per month at market prices.
